Stomopteryx maledicta is a moth of the Gelechiidae family. It was described by Meyrick in 1921. It is found in Indonesia (Java).

The wingspan is about 9 mm. The forewings are dark grey speckled with grey-whitish throughout. The plical stigma is cloudy, obscurely darker, sometimes preceded and followed by slight whitish suffusion. The hindwings are grey.
